Nothing Phone 3 Renders Leaked Ahead of July 1 Launch; Reveal Distinctive Rear Camera Layout

The Nothing Phone 3 is set to go official next week alongside the Headphone 1. Just days before the launch, new renders of the Phone 3 have leaked, showcasing the design. The alleged renders show the new ‘Glyph Matrix’ display that floats independently in the top corner of the device. The rear camera sensors of the Nothing Phone 3 are not fixed to a particular spot in the images. The Nothing Phone 3 is already confirmed to be powered by the Snapdragon 8s Gen 4 chipset. It will include a 50-megapixel periscope telephoto sensor on the rear.

Nothing Phone 3 Design Leaked

Shared by Android Headlines, the new alleged renders of the Nothing Phone 3 suggest a black and white colour option for the phone. It is seen with a hole punch display design and has a Glyph-matrix interface on the rear panel. The design language appears slightly similar to the Phone 3a and Phone 3a Pro models.

The official-looking renders show a unique camera arrangement on the Phone 3. The top camera is positioned on the left side and is not aligned with the other two sensors. These two sensors are arranged next to each other, close to the edge of the phone. The newly leaked renders align with recent design teasers shared by Nothing.

Nothing is set to reveal the Phone 1 alongside the Headphone 1 on July 1. The company has already announced that the Phone 3 will ship with a Snapdragon 8s Gen 4 chipset and a 50-megapixel periscope telephoto camera. The brand will provide five years of Android OS updates for the phone. It is confirmed to receive seven years of security patches as well.

While we don’t have confirmation about the rest of the camera array, a recent leak stated that it will include a 50-megapixel primary and ultrawide sensors. The handset is tipped to include a 50-megapixel selfie camera. It is rumoured to come with a 6.7-inch LTPO OLED display with 1.5K resolution

Nothing is expected to pack a 5,150mAh battery on the Phone 3 with support for 100W wired charging. The phone could support 15W wireless charging.
